Research Assosciate
-Developed a deletion construct by knocking out an utert gene (telomerase) to study the haplo-insuffeciency of Ustilago Maydis.-Generated the utert U.Maydis complementation construct by cloning the carboxin resistence ORF into TOPO-UTERT-GFP vector at the SfiI restriction site. The vectors are linearized with SfiI and integrated in U.Maydis at the ip locus. Accomplished gene deletion and gene integration in U.Maydis through homologous recombination techniques. -Created utert deletion construct by using SfiI technique and screen the transformants with desired replacements with PCR. -Employed Echerichia coli strains DH5 and TOPO10 for all cloning applications. Used pCR2.1 TOPO TA for cloning of PCR products. Employed techniques like DNA isolation, Plasmid isolation, Ligation, RNA extraction, Bacterial Transformation, Bacterial Cell Culture for acquiring results.
